Yardley Borough, Bucks County has received funding through the Severe Repetitive Loss Program, administered by the Pennsylvania Emergency Management Agency, in order to elevate the existing home located at 119 South Bell Avenue above the 100-year flood plain in Yardley Borough, Bucks County, PA. The work consists of, but is not limited to: Elevate and temporarily support the existing structure, construct new foundation footings and walls where shown, backfill existing crawlspace and basement, provide lintels for foundation wall openings, disconnect, relocate, extend and reconnect existing utilities, electrical, plumbing and mechanical equipment, install flood vents, provide access to the elevated structure, and restore all disturbed areas and landscaping. The Scope of Work is more fully described in the Project Specifications herein and on the Project Plans. Questions Due Date: Sep 4th 2026, 5:00 PM EDT Online Portal Project Description 1.
